Rethinking Female Sainthood: Michèle Roberts’ Spiritual Quest in Impossible Saints
Women’s marginalized position in Christianity has been a central concern in much of Michèle Roberts’ fiction, springing from her Catholic education and her awareness of the sexist ideology underlying Christian doctrine.
